Fenwick Render (the markdown pipeline) ships as a single container. Plugins load from the mounted extensions directory at boot; no hot reload. Build your plugin against the published ABI, drop it in, restart. Staging and prod differ only in worker count and sanitizer strictness — test against staging first. Rollbacks are image-tag swaps; plugin state is stateless by contract, so don't persist anything locally. Health checks hit the render probe every ten seconds. The deployment configuration the container boots with is listed below.

deployment values, tafof-taduf:
pelius:
  pin: 6508
  tenant: praiel
  seal: seal_4e33a2f4
  metrics_host: metrics.pelius.plorvagrid.corp
  standby_team: druix
  escalation: juldor-norius
  nonce: 5db598

The Fabricant library's user-factory populates password fields from a static wordlist instead of the randomizer, so generated fixtures contain predictable credentials. These fixtures are committed to the shared snapshot bucket, which external QA at Ostbridge can read. No production secrets are involved, but the pattern could mask a real leak. Reproduced on the nightly pipeline with default settings. The reproducing build is identified by the token recorded immediately below.

build token for fajof-yahof: htk4_869f

The health checks behind the Bramblegate load balancer were failing intermittently because the /ready endpoint also probed the Quillstore database, so a slow query marked healthy nodes as down. I've split readiness from liveness: /live is local-only, /ready checks dependencies with a 500ms budget. Please review the timeout constants and the drain behavior on deregistration. One operational note: the balancer's admin plane is sealed after failover, and the recovery passphrase needed to reopen it is below.

vault phrase of tajop-haduf = holath-brivan-wenax

Welcome to the Quillfern support crew! This week we're rolling out the new consent banner across all Brindlehop storefronts. Customers will see it once per device, so expect a few confused tickets — just point them to the macro in Tidepool. Before you can push banner config tweaks to staging, you'll need the deploy key, which is pasted below.

rollout seal: bky4_x7Gc